About the Founder

PDC’s Founder, Craig LaPierre, with an extensive background in machine trades and engineering, after six years serving in the U.S. Army NG as an Air Traffic Controller, Craig began his die casting career. Joining Techmire, the world leader in the manufacture of multi-slide die casting equipment, in the 1980s, he was privileged to gain invaluable experience.

With a wealth of experience as a Dynacast Production Manager, Craig was responsible for producing $250,000,000 in multi-slide die castings per year and helped develop ACUZinc5, a proprietary General Motors alloy.

In 2001, Craig founded Precision Die Cast, Inc., in Clinton Township, MI, and the company has continued to grow through booms and recessions.

At the heart of expert die casting, what makes the critical difference is two aspects of the business. First, knowing the intricacies of the machines to obtain the finest results. Second, having a depth of working knowledge about the combination of alloys to guide customers to the appropriate solution for their application.

Through a lifetime of hands-on experience, strong leadership, and business development, Craig enjoys providing outstanding service to his customers.

Our History of Service

Timeline

PDC Founded

Precision Die Cast – PDC – founded by Craig LaPierre, Smiths Creek, Michigan.

Investing in Production

Purchased first Techmire four-slide die casting machine, adding to PDC’s four Dynacast

Bolstering Capacity

Purchased first Techmire 66 die casting machine.

Quality Certification

Registered to ISO 9002:2000 quality system standard.

Getting Smaller with Accuracy

Purchase a conventional die casting machine, improving consistency and efficiency for increasingly smaller and more complex parts.

Superior Thread Milling

Started production machining threads for precise thread profile.

Thriving in Economic Downturns

Operating with zero debt load and contract diversity, PDC thrived throughout the economic downturn.

Upgrading Quality Processes

Upgraded to ISO 9001:2008 quality system standard.

Always Improving

Upgraded to ISO 9001:2015 quality system standard.

Precision Mold and Prototype Capability

CNC production machining capability for dies and molds ensures high tolerance, precision, repeatability, and consistency.

Multiplying Capacity

Acquired 10 multislide and conventional casting machines with contracts.

Expanding Facility

Relocated to Kimball, MI, with a 20,000 sq. ft. facility for greater capacity.
